Has Active Noise Cancellation (Noise Control)

Bowers & Wilkins PI7
Tozo T10S

ANC makes use of advanced kind of tech to actively cancel noise. ANC works when, it listens to the sound pattern of incoming noise and generates a mirror signal to counter it. Simply put, it's like having +1 (sound from your surrounding) then producing -1 (inverted noise) giving zero resulting in a reduced level of noise.

The Bowers & Wilkins PI7 have Active Noise Cancellation allowing you to listen at lower levels of volume, causing less ear fatigue since you don't have to crank up the earbuds volume to outcompete background sounds.

Driver Unit Size

Bowers & Wilkins PI7 9.2mm
Tozo T10S 8mm

The Tozo T10S have a unit size of 8mm in diameter, bigger drivers are more powerful, therefor producing better bass. A driver unit is the component that makes sound in the device, its size corellates with the sound produced by the device.

Bowers & Wilkins PI7 driver unit is 9.2mm in diameter, making them have a larger driver unit than that of Tozo T10S by 1.2mm , a common assumption that driver units of a bigger size automatically produce better sound quality.

However, large drivers find it difficult to produce high frequencies so yeah, larger drivers can generate louder sound, but this does not imply that they deliver better quality sound.

Has Aac

Bowers & Wilkins PI7
Tozo T10S

Tozo T10S support AAC, a codec that is used for Bluetooth audio. It supports 24-bit audio at 250kbps. Since it uses psychoacoustic modeling, it provides better results than other codecs at the same bit rate.

Since its the highest quality codec that any Bluetooth-supporting Apple product supports, the Tozo T10S will work well with your MacBook. If you intend on using these with Android you need to pay even closer attention to codec support for if they only have AAC they won't provide the best audio quality possible, ensure that they also support aptX HD, LDAC, or LHDC as well.

The Bowers & Wilkins PI7 support AAC as well. Designed to be the successor of the MP3 format, AAC generally achieves higher sound quality than MP3 encoders at the same bit rate.
